// Copyright 2006-2010, Thomas Walters, Willem van Engen // // AIM-C: A C++ implementation of the Auditory Image Model // http://www.acousticscale.org/AIMC // // Licensed under the Apache License, Version 2.0 (the "License"); // you may not use this file except in compliance with the License. // You may obtain a copy of the License at // // http://www.apache.org/licenses/LICENSE-2.0 // // Unless required by applicable law or agreed to in writing, software // distributed under the License is distributed on an "AS IS" BASIS, // WITHOUT WARRANTIES OR CONDITIONS OF ANY KIND, either express or implied. // See the License for the specific language governing permissions and // limitations under the License. /*! \file * \brief Common includes for all AIM-C */ /*! \author: Thomas Walters <tom@acousticscale.org> * \author: Willem van Engen <cnbh@willem.engen.nl> * \date 2010/01/30 * \version \$Id$ */ #ifndef AIMC_SUPPORT_COMMON_H_ #define AIMC_SUPPORT_COMMON_H_ #include <stdlib.h> #include <stdio.h> #include <stdarg.h> // Defines for windows #ifdef _WINDOWS #define M_PI 3.14159265359 #define isnan _isnan #define isinf(x) (!_finite(x)) #define snprintf _snprintf #define PATH_MAX _MAX_PATH #endif #define AIM_NAME "AIM-C" #define AIM_VERSION_STRING "version_number" // A macro to disallow the copy constructor and operator= functions // This should be used in the private: declarations for a class #define DISALLOW_COPY_AND_ASSIGN(TypeName) \ TypeName(const TypeName&); \ void operator=(const TypeName&) #if !defined(_T) # ifdef _UNICODE # define _T(x) L ## x # else # define _T(x) x # endif #endif #if !defined(_S) # ifdef _UNICODE # define _S(x) L ## x # else # define _S(x) x # endif #endif /*! \brief C++ delete if != NULL * * This was used so often, that is was moved to a macro. */ #define DELETE_IF_NONNULL(x) { \ if ( (x) ) { \ delete (x); \ (x) = NULL; \ } \ } /*! \brief C++ delete[] if != NULL * * This was used so often, that is was moved to a macro. */ #define DELETE_ARRAY_IF_NONNULL(x) { \ if ( (x) ) { \ delete[] (x); \ (x) = NULL; \ } \ } /*! \brief C free if != NULL * * This was used so often, that is was moved to a macro. */ #define FREE_IF_NONNULL(x) { \ if ( (x) ) { \ free(x); \ (x) = NULL; \ } \ } #ifdef DEBUG # define AIM_VERIFY(x) AIM_ASSERT(x) # define AIM_ASSERT(x) { \ if (!(x)) { \ LOG_ERROR("Assertion failed.\n"); \ *(reinterpret_cast<char*>(0)) = 0; \ } \ } #else # define AIM_VERIFY(x) {x;} # define AIM_ASSERT(...) #endif namespace aimc { void LOG_ERROR(const char *sFmt, ...); void LOG_INFO(const char *sFmt, ...); void LOG_INFO_NN(const char *sFmt, ...); } // namespace aimc #endif // AIMC_SUPPORT_COMMON_H_
